
вот нашёл в интернете интересный проект: http://mrhx.clan.su/load/ (JScript тоже поддерживает)
VISG это программа для визуального построения графического интерфейса пользователя (GUI) с возможностью генерирования текста алгоритма для построения этого интерфейса под разные платформы. Под платформой тут следует понимать операционную систему, язык программирования, используемые библиотеки, а также методы программирования.
На данный момент, VISG обладает следующими возможностями:
Позволяет визуально проектировать графический интерфейс пользователя.
Позволяет генерировать исходный текст программы для созданного интерфейса под разные платформы.
Поддерживает специальный язык описания исходника для того, чтобы любой пользователь мог бы добавить поддержку своего языка программирования в программу, либо изменить текущие скрипты генерации под свои нужны.
Поддерживает плагины. Они текстовые и язык их описания очень простой. Можно с легкостью добавлять новые контролы, пункты меню, новые возможности.
Поддержка всех встроенных контролов MS Windows и всех стилей для них.
На данный момент VISG знает про следующие языки программирования: C, Pascal (Free Pascal, Delphi), Assembler (masm, tasm, lzasm).
На данный момент VISG умеет использовать следующие библиотеки: Win32API, Xlib.
Сгенерированный исходник можно тут же собрать без дополнительных модификаций.
Удобный интерфейс.
Интерфейс многоязычен. И его легко перевести самому на другой язык.
Программа не тормозит.
Программа компактна.
Работает под MS Windows, Linux+Wine.
Программа бесплатна.
Тестировано на: MSVC++, Delphi, Free Pascal, devcpp, TASM, MASM, lzasm, gcc.